  • Online holiday sales surge 8.4% to $241.4 billion for 2024  

    Adobe released its 2024 online holiday shopping trends: Paid search drives the most retail sales this holiday season at nearly 30% of revenue. But influencers increase their share of holiday sales the most and convert shoppers nine-times higher than social media overall.   U.S. online holiday sales increased 8.4% year over year, reaching a record of […]

  • Super Saturday brings in big bucks for mass merchants, off-price retailers and Ulta  

    The last Saturday before Christmas, Dec. 21, drove many shoppers to the store, with foot traffic surging compared to a typical Saturday in the holiday season. Beauty stores surpassed their pre-pandemic foot traffic levels, while department store foot traffic decreased 25% compared with Super Saturday 2019.   The Saturday before Christmas Day, Dec. 21, dubbed […]

  • Ecommerce claims growing share of Black Friday sales 

    Analysis shows a ‘modest’ increase in Black Friday foot traffic and store sales, while online sales surge year over year, according to new data from the NRF, Mastercard SpendingPulse and Placer.ai.  On Black Friday 2024, U.S. retail sales increased 3.4% year over year, according to Mastercard SpendingPulse.
